One of the dominant themes in Hikvision's 2021 strategy was the integration of Artificial Intelligence (AI) across its entire product portfolio. This wasn't simply the addition of AI features as an afterthought; rather, it represented a fundamental shift in the design philosophy. AI-powered analytics became integral to many of their cameras, NVRs (Network Video Recorders), and VMS (Video Management Systems), significantly enhancing the capabilities of traditional surveillance systems. Features like facial recognition, license plate recognition (LPR), object detection and tracking, and intrusion detection were refined and made more accurate, enabling proactive security measures and streamlining investigative processes.

Hikvision's 2021 product line-up showcased a significant emphasis on high-resolution imaging. The adoption of 4K and even 8K resolution cameras became increasingly prevalent, allowing for unparalleled detail and clarity in captured footage. This level of detail proved invaluable in identifying individuals, vehicles, and events with greater precision, especially in challenging lighting conditions. The increased resolution also enabled more effective digital zoom capabilities without significant loss of quality, expanding the operational range and flexibility of surveillance deployments.

Beyond resolution, Hikvision focused on improving low-light performance. Technological advancements in sensor technology and image processing algorithms resulted in cameras capable of producing clear, usable video even in extremely low-light environments. This was particularly beneficial in nighttime surveillance applications, significantly broadening the effectiveness of security systems in diverse settings, including parking lots, streets, and perimeters.

The integration of deep learning algorithms played a crucial role in enhancing the accuracy and reliability of AI-powered analytics. These algorithms allowed for more sophisticated pattern recognition, reducing false alarms and improving the overall performance of the systems. For example, advancements in facial recognition technology enabled more accurate identification even with variations in lighting, angles, and partial obscurations. This was crucial in applications such as access control and perimeter security.

In terms of infrastructure, Hikvision continued to refine its network video recorders (NVRs) and video management systems (VMS). Their NVRs offered improved storage capacity and faster processing speeds, facilitating the efficient management of high-resolution video streams from multiple cameras. The VMS platforms were enhanced with intuitive user interfaces, making it easier for security personnel to monitor and manage large-scale deployments. Furthermore, the integration with third-party systems and platforms became more seamless, allowing for greater interoperability and data sharing.

Hikvision's 2021 solutions also addressed the growing demand for cybersecurity. The company invested heavily in strengthening the security of its products and systems, implementing robust measures to protect against cyber threats and data breaches. This included advanced encryption protocols, secure boot processes, and regular security updates to mitigate vulnerabilities.
